Bharat Sanchar Nigam Limited (BSNL) has achieved a major breakthrough by successfully testing its indigenous 5G technology on the 3.6 GHz and 700 MHz bands. This milestone highlights India’s push towards self-reliance in telecommunications as BSNL prepares for a 5G launch by early 2025. Here’s how BSNL’s efforts are reshaping the telecom landscape in India.

BSNL Successfully Tests Made In India 5G Tech: Launch In Early 2025!

Indigenous 5G Trials in Key Spectrum Bands

Union Telecom Minister Jyotiraditya Scindia announced that BSNL has conducted successful trials of 5G radio access networks (RAN) and core infrastructure in both the 3.6 GHz and 700 MHz bands. This testing underscores BSNL’s commitment to pioneering homegrown 5G technology. Notably, BSNL’s access to the premium 700 MHz band—a frequency known for its extensive coverage—is an advantage only shared with Reliance Jio, given its high costs that deterred other operators.

4G Sites to Transition Smoothly to 5G by 2025

Currently, BSNL has deployed around 39,000 4G sites across urban and rural regions, with plans to expand these to 1 lakh sites by mid-2025. The operator’s existing 4G sites are strategically planned to support 5G upgrades, ensuring a smoother and faster transition for users once the 5G rollout begins. This upgrade plan is expected to reach a significant portion of the population, further strengthening BSNL’s connectivity reach.

Focus on Cost-Efficiency to Attract New Customers

BSNL’s decision to refrain from a tariff hike, as confirmed by CMD Robert J. Ravi, aligns with the goal of growing its customer base. As private telecom companies increased their tariffs, BSNL witnessed a surge in new subscribers, especially in July 2024, according to the TRAI report. By maintaining affordable rates, BSNL is likely to continue attracting budget-conscious users, particularly in rural areas.
